genpadalecki: kicking our green game up a notch with a few of our fav eco-conscious footwear brands.
tread lightly, towwnies! share your favorite sustainable shoes in the comments below.
@fredasalvador - handcrafted in family-run factories in spain & el salvador, these designer shoes are responsibly sourced using high-quality leathers, ensuring longevity while minimizing environmental impact.
@rothys - this bestselling brand embodies sustainability through circularity, utilizing twice-recycled materials in its innovative shoes. 179+ million single-use plastic bottles have been repurposed into thread.
@vivaia - crafted from recycled materials, including plastic bottles & post-consumer waste, these circular shoes are made with innovative 3D knitting technology to ensure a perfect fit + minimize excess production.
@pangaia - sourced from Italian vineyards & manufactured in portugal, this stylish & science-back brand repurposes grape byproducts from winemaking that typically go to waste, and the raw materials are transformed into chic sneaks.
@veja - designed in paris/made in brazil, the brand uses natural materials like organic cotton, sugar cane, rice waste & more, working directly with farmers in pre-production to ensure equitable practices.

On October 6th, celebrity-loved global women’s footwear and lifestyle brand, VIVAIA, opened its doors to a first-ever retail experiential pop-up in SoHo, NYC at 89 Crosby St. — marking the brand's inaugural brick and mortar debut in the U.S.
The 2,000 Square-Foot NYC pop-up introduces an immersive shopping experience, inviting consumers to touch, feel, and play in VIVAIA’s celebrated cloud-like, no-break-in-period-needed collections which feature fan-favorite Mary Jane ballet flats, running heels, boots, and more, as well as an limited-edition capsule of in-store exclusive styles.

VIVAIA celebrated the debut of the NYC pop-up with an exclusive VIP grand opening party on October 5th with high-profile tastemakers, VIPs, media and brand friends. The pop up will remain open to the public for 17-days – from October 6th - October 22nd between the hours of 11 am to 7 pm on Monday through Saturday and 11am to 6pm on Sunday.Founded in 2020 by serial entrepreneur and footwear industry vet, Marina Chen, the pop-up follows suit to the eco-friendly brand’s viral disruption into the US market, which has captivated city urbanites and A-list celebrities alike including Katie Holmes, Selena Gomez, Emma Roberts, Scarlett Johansson, Alexa Chung, and more, with their reimagined approach to cutting-edge footwear at the intersection of style, function, and comfort.
